Corporate Profile

Established in 1889, Essex County Council stands as a pillar of public service in the UK, committed to enhancing the quality of life for its residents. Operating from its headquarters in Chelmsford, the council dedicates itself to addressing the diverse needs of the community through effective governance and progressive policies. With a workforce of 11,000 employees, the council is well-equipped to manage an array of services that cater to the wellbeing and development of Essex's populace.

The council's comprehensive service portfolio focuses on crucial public needs such as education, transport, and social care. By prioritising community support and infrastructure development, Essex County Council ensures that residents have access to essential resources and opportunities for growth. Through strategic planning and implementation, the council addresses environmental management and strives to create sustainable living conditions for future generations.
